// Regression guards for the RFC 7523 §3 (2) + §3 (4) sub-and-exp-required fix.
//
// jwx's `WithValidate(true)` honors `sub` and `exp` when present but does
// not require them. The OAuth service now supplements with explicit
// checks for both required claims on both the jwt_bearer assertion and
// the token_exchange actor_token; these tests ensure those supplements
// stay in place across future refactors.

package integration_test

import (
"crypto/ecdsa"
"crypto/elliptic"
"crypto/rand"
"net/http"
"testing"
"time"

"github.com/lestrrat-go/jwx/v4/jwa"
"github.com/lestrrat-go/jwx/v4/jwt"
"github.com/stretchr/testify/assert"
"github.com/stretchr/testify/require"
)

// signAssertionWithClaims builds a jwt-bearer assertion from a caller-supplied
// claims map. Tests deliberately omit either `sub` or `exp` to exercise the
// negative-space MUSTs of RFC 7523 §3 (2) and §3 (4).
func signAssertionWithClaims(t *testing.T, key *ecdsa.PrivateKey, claims map[string]any) string {
t.Helper()
b := jwt.NewBuilder()
for k, v := range claims {
b = b.Claim(k, v)
}
tok, err := b.Build()
require.NoError(t, err)
signed, err := jwt.Sign(tok, jwt.WithKey(jwa.ES256(), key))
require.NoError(t, err)
return string(signed)
}

func TestJwtBearer_ExpClaimRequired(t *testing.T) {
// RFC 7523 §3 (4): "The JWT MUST contain an 'exp' (expiration) claim
// that limits the time window during which the JWT can be used."
key, err := ecdsa.GenerateKey(elliptic.P256(), rand.Reader)
require.NoError(t, err)
agentID := uid("exp-required-jwt-bearer")
identity := registerIdentity(t, agentID, []string{"data:read"}, ecPublicKeyPEM(t, key))

now := time.Now()
bad := signAssertionWithClaims(t, key, map[string]any{
"iss": identity.WIMSEURI,
"sub": identity.WIMSEURI,
"aud": testIssuer,
"iat": now.Unix(),
// exp deliberately omitted
})

resp := post(t, "/oauth2/token", map[string]any{
"grant_type": "urn:ietf:params:oauth:grant-type:jwt-bearer",
"subject": bad,
"scope": "data:read",
}, nil)
require.Equal(t, http.StatusBadRequest, resp.StatusCode,
"jwt-bearer assertion without exp MUST be rejected")
body := decode(t, resp)
assert.Equal(t, "invalid_grant", body["error"])
desc, _ := body["error_description"].(string)
assert.Contains(t, desc, "exp",
"error_description should name the missing claim — proves the new check fired, not some other validator")
}
